R&D Manager

KNOWLTON TECHNOLOGIES LLCWatertown, NY

About The Position

Responsible for research, planning, and implementing new programs and protocols into our company. You will also be required to oversee the entire development process of new products and programs within the organization. Your active participation will be required from the initial planning phase to implementation or production. Additionally, you are required to keep track of all the costs related to the creation of these new products and decide what ideas are worth pursuing. You should also stay informed on what is happening in the research and development field at large to make sure the company is up-to-date and current with the most advanced R&D developments. Manage and direct R&D activities concerned with development, application, and maintenance of all product lines associated with Knowlton.
